HI COM band scan
@ Push [CLR] to select frequency mode.
@® Set [SQLJ to the point where noise is just muted.
@ Push [F] then [A-UP SCAN] or [W-DN SCAN] to start
the scan.
When a signal is received, the scan pauses until it disap-
pears. To resume the scan, rotate the tuning dial or push the
[A] or[¥] key.
* To change the scanning direction, rotate the tuning dial or
push the [A]
or [W] key.
@ To stop the scan, push [CLR].
Hi Memory scan
@ Push [MR] to select memory mode.
@® Set [SQL] to the point where noise is just muted.
@ Push [F] then [A-UP SCAN] or [W-DN SCAN] to start
the scan,
« When a signal is received, the scan pauses until it disap-
pears. To resume the scan, rotate the tuning dial or push the
[A] or [¥] key.
* To change the scanning direction, rotate the tuning dial or
push the [A] or['W] key.
@ To stop the scan, push [CLR].
